Product Description:
Bosch Rexroth Indramat manufactures the MDD093D-N-030-N2M-110PB2 synchronous motor as part of the MDD Synchronous Motors series. Classified as a motor for digital drive controllers, the unit couples directly to compatible power modules and supplies controlled torque and speed to industrial positioning tables, pick-and-place gantries, and packaging spindles. Its permanent-magnet rotor and integrated multi-turn encoder allow the drive to monitor absolute shaft angle, while the blocking brake secures the load when power is removed. This arrangement supports precise starts, stops, and holding functions in closed-loop motion systems.
During continuous stall operation, the rotor can develop 24.0 Nm of torque without exceeding thermal limits, letting the motor hold static loads or move slowly with high force. Under rated electrical frequency, it reaches a nominal speed of 3000 rpm, so it pairs with gear stages or direct drives that call for medium-speed motion. The integrated brake provides 22 Nm of holding torque to help prevent drift on vertical axes. Mechanical centering uses a 110 mm pilot diameter that fits standard mounting flanges. Power, brake, and feedback lines exit on side B through a sealed connector interface, and the keyed circular connector keeps all electrical connections grouped at one end of the housing.
Feedback is delivered as digital servo feedback from the integrated multi-turn absolute encoder, allowing accurate phase control and position tracking. The shaft uses a keyway for positive torque transmission to couplings, and the shaft seal helps keep coolant or oil spray away from the bearing space. The motor has a standard housing within the 093 frame, while motor length code D gives it a longer active lamination stack for higher continuous torque than shorter lengths in the same frame size. The single-ended design leaves no shaft extension on side B, which reduces protruding parts around the cable outlet and keeps the drive end clear for mechanical coupling.
